Transaction 770f6553ace5cd63a246df50decb236653361db6bb18ea94c637992822ba7367
1 Input
1 Output
-
770f6553ace5cd63a246df50decb236653361db6bb18ea94c637992822ba7367:0
- value
- 579486
- script pubkey
- OP_0 OP_PUSHBYTES_32 c07ca00367524d18c0a5a0b66cd66260488595bc7029700475ae149eaeab9cbd
- address
- bc1qcp72qqm82fx33s995zmxe4nzvpygt9duwq5hqpr44c2fat4tnj7sp69q55